Managing OS X Server from Windows

Is there a way to manage OS X Server from Windows? Is there a Windows-version of Server Preferences or Server Admin. I guess not? Or via a webinterface?
How do people here manage their OS X Servers from Windows?

My suggestion is use VNC to connect to your server remotely and then use the server admin and workgroup manager from the server to manage it. You can turn on sharing for VNC under system preferences / sharing. RealVNC works well as do many other. As for a windows version of server admin, I don't think one exists, but VNC is how we manage at this point when on a Windows box.
